# Catalog Cache Invalidation: Limits & Quotas

Heads up for reviewers: the Shopwren catalog cache invalidates on a push model, so a flood of SKU updates can hammer the invalidation queue. We cap bursts per tenant and rate-limit wildcard purges, since those are the expensive (and abusable) ones. Anything over quota gets deferred, not dropped. Teodor's team owns the enforcement layer; escalations go through the usual channel. The enforced limits are defined in code as follows.

tuning table, yajog-yahof:
BUDGETS = {
    "lamvan": 303,
    "wenox": 460,
    "fenvan": 525,
}

/*
 * DeployDuck client setup — for external plugin authors.
 *
 * DeployDuck posts deploy status updates into team channels and
 * answers queries like "what's live in staging?" Plugins register
 * handlers here; each handler receives the parsed event payload
 * and a reply function. Rate limits apply per plugin (30 req/min).
 * The client must authenticate to the DeployDuck gateway on init;
 * in development builds it uses the key below.
 */

service key, fawip-bajef: kto11_Qt5wZK9vdNC

Runbook: Lumebase template rendering slowdowns. If p95 render time creeps past 400ms, it's almost always the partial cache getting evicted by the nightly import — check the cache hit ratio first. Restarting the render pool buys you an hour, tops; the real fix is bumping the cache ceiling in render.toml and redeploying. Don't touch the template compiler flags unless Priya's around, that bit is fragile. Sample queries, known-bad templates, and the full escalation tree are collected on the render-perf page.

runbook for badug-kadup: https://confluence.zemvarlabs.internal/projects/browse/display/projects/bd1b

## Bloomgate cache layer — quick triage

If Kestrelvault reads spike while hit rates look fine, the bloom filter in front is probably saturated — false positives climb past 3% and everything falls through to disk. Don't panic: rotate the filter with the `rebloom` job, which rebuilds from the keyspace snapshot in about four minutes. Traffic keeps flowing during rebuild, just slower. Before you rotate, grab the current filter's build token for the incident log; it's shown below.

trace token, fafog-kageg: htk4_98e6